Output 5976de6578f454ca68900d7a69f03f06c0537b481a6fc57c43d00295570c0592:59

value
10000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d1a25692fa2a46c48831e5b454fa65914174606eb3bf2dfa709a10c12e3c577
address
bc1pe5dz26f052jxcjyrred52naxty2pw3sxaval9ha8pxsscyhrc4ms38x4vk
transaction
5976de6578f454ca68900d7a69f03f06c0537b481a6fc57c43d00295570c0592
spent
true